KA YING GENERATION (J075): When questioned regarding his riding, A Atzeni stated that his intention was to ride his mount in a forward position in a similar way in which it was ridden when it performed well in the Hong Kong Derby on 24 March 2024. He said in the early stages when MOMENTS IN TIME held the lead, he was aware that the pace of the event was being run inside of standard time, however, KA YING GENERATION was travelling comfortably in a position to the outside of MOMENTS IN TIME. He added that from the 800 Metres KA YING GENERATION came under pressure and failed to finish the race off from that point. When asked if there was an opportunity to take a trailing position behind MOMENTS IN TIME, A Atzeni stated that due to his mount carrying a light weight and it had raced well when being allowed to run freely at its last start, he felt that his best option was to remain racing outside of MOMENTS IN TIME to take advantage of the light weight. He said however with the benefit of hindsight, he may have been better suited by obtaining cover in the middle stages behind MOMENTS IN TIME. A veterinary inspection immediately following the race did not show any significant findings. The Stewards found the performance of KA YING GENERATION to be disappointing as compared to its previous race start. Before being allowed to race again, KA YING GENERATION will be required to perform to the satisfaction of the Stewards in a barrier trial and be subjected to an official veterinary examination.
